Newborn Swaddling At Night . Swaddling your newborn at night can help your baby sleep longer stretches at night. Swaddling a baby means wrapping them in a blanket or a swaddling. Swaddling for short periods of time is likely fine, but if your baby is going to spend a significant amount of the day and night swaddled, consider using a swaddling sleep sack that lets the legs move. The technique is helpful when babies fuss and fidget, especially when going to sleep. Figuring out the right swaddle for your newborn can be tricky, and the transition out of the swaddle can be even more challenging! Swaddling is a way to make your baby feel safe and comfortable by wrapping the baby in a blanket. The purpose of swaddling is to help reduce the “startle or moro” reflex. Swaddling means snugly wrapping a baby in a blanket for warmth and security. If you are going to swaddle your baby, there are a few safety recommendations you need to be aware of. Yes, you should swaddle your newborn. Swaddling helps babies settle, relax, sleep well and accept the bassinet or crib. It mimics the closeness and warmth of the womb,. And a sleeping baby equals a happy parent. Some babies fall asleep faster when they are swaddled. Most commonly referred to as swaddling, wrapping your baby up as snug as a bug in a baby blanket before putting them down to sleep can be helpful.
